Location

Location is an important factor to consider when choosing a dentist for your child. You want to choose a dental practice that is easily accessible and located in a safe and convenient area.

Ideally, you should look for a kid’s dentist that is close to your home or workplace. This will help reduce the amount of time and effort required to get there, especially if your child needs regular check-ups or treatments.

It’s also important to consider the surrounding environment of the dental office. Is it located in an area that feels secure? Will there be ample parking available during peak hours? These are all factors that can affect your overall experience when visiting the dentist with your child.

Another aspect worth considering is whether or not the location offers any additional amenities, such as play areas or waiting rooms designed specifically for kids. These can help make visits more enjoyable and comfortable for children who may otherwise feel anxious about going to the dentist.

When searching for a kid’s dentist, don’t forget to take location into account. A conveniently located practice with added perks like special waiting areas can make all the difference in ensuring good oral health habits among young patients!

Staffing

The staffing of a kid’s dentist’s office is a crucial component to consider when choosing the best dental care provider for your child. The staff should be friendly, knowledgeable, and have experience working with children.

A good indicator of quality staffing is how they interact with patients. Are they warm and welcoming? Do they answer questions in an informative and patient manner? These are important factors to pay attention to when evaluating the staff at a potential kid’s dentist’s office.

Another aspect to keep in mind is whether or not the staff has specialized training in pediatric dentistry. A great kid’s dentist team will have expertise in dealing with unique issues that arise during oral exams for young children, such as cavities, braces, orthodontics, extractions, or gum diseases.

You want your child to feel comfortable while receiving dental care, so it’s vital that the entire team works together seamlessly, from front desk receptionists all the way through hygienists and dentists themselves, ensuring that each visit runs smoothly without any hiccups.

Dental Services Offered

When choosing a kid’s dentist, it’s important to consider the range of dental services offered. A good pediatric dentist should provide comprehensive care for your child’s oral health needs.

One essential service that every pediatric dentist should offer is routine check-ups and cleanings. Regular dental visits can prevent tooth decay and catch potential problems early on. In addition to preventive care, your child may also need restorative treatments such as fillings or crowns.

Orthodontic treatment is another important service that some pediatric dentists may offer. If your child needs braces or other orthodontic appliances, it can be convenient to have all their dental needs taken care of in one place.

For children who are anxious about visiting the dentist, sedation dentistry may be an option. This can help ensure that they receive the necessary treatments without feeling scared or uncomfortable.

The specific services you’ll need will depend on your child’s individual oral health needs. When selecting a kid’s dentist, consider not only what services are offered but also how they’re delivered—with patience and kindness—to make sure you find the right fit for your family.

Cost of Services

When choosing a kid’s dentist, it’s important to consider the cost of services. Dental care can be expensive, so finding an affordable option is crucial for many families.

First and foremost, it’s important to understand what your insurance will cover. Many dental offices accept different types of insurance and can help you navigate the coverage options available to you.

If you don’t have dental insurance or if your plan doesn’t cover certain procedures, ask about payment plans or financing options that may be available. Some dentists offer in-house financing or work with third-party providers like Care Credit to make dental care more accessible.

It’s also worth comparing prices between different dentists in your area. Keep in mind that the cheapest option isn’t always the best choice; quality of care should always come first when it comes to your child’s oral health.

While cost is certainly an important factor when choosing a kid’s dentist, it shouldn’t be the only one. Consider all factors carefully before making a decision that will impact your child’s oral health for years to come.
